Rincón de la Subbética is an organic extra virgin olive oil produced by Almazaras de la Subbética in the mountains of Córdoba, Spain. It is a blend of a single-varietal Hojiblanca olive that has won more than 720 awards throughout its history.
This extra virgin olive oil of the Hojiblanca variety is produced by manual and automated harvesting by the members of the cooperatives that are grouped within Almaliva, under the Almazaras de la Subbética brand .
The olive groves from which the olives for this extra virgin olive oil come are in many cases centuries old, and have been cared for by multiple generations of farmers from the mountains of Córdoba .
It is produced during the first days of October, seeking the optimal harvest point, just like other oils you can find in our collection of premium extra virgin olive oils . The time between harvesting and milling, which is done cold, is minimized. This enhances the aromas and flavors of this oil.
Furthermore, this oil is included within the Protected Designation of Origin of Priego de Córdoba, which ensures the quality standards of EVOO of the Hojiblanca and Picudo varieties produced in this region.
The Hojiblanca variety produces an impeccable and amazing oil , with a strong fruity aroma of green olives and grass, giving way to notes of tomato and artichoke, and finishing with fruits like banana. It has great complexity in its flavor.

This oil is the selection of the Oro del Desierto mill master. The first oils obtained between late October and early November, from the Arbequina, Hojiblanca, and Picual varieties, are stored in 2,000L batches where they are analyzed and selected before being blended in different proportions for this limited annual run.

This tasting pack contains the four single-varietal grape varieties produced by Finca la Torre on its Málaga estates. It includes Hojiblanca, Arbequina, Cornicabra, and Picudo.
El Oro del Desierto Picual is an organic extra virgin olive oil that captures all the strength and freshness of the Tabernas Desert in Almería. Produced from early-harvested Picual olives, this oil stands out for its intense character, the result of efforts to preserve its natural and sustainable essence.
